Health Science Student Demographics at Niagara County Community College

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the health science majors at Niagara County Community College.

Niagara County Community College Health Sciences & Services Associate’s Program

83% Women
For the most recent academic year available, 17% of health science associate's degrees went to men and 83% went to women.
